Word: Sphincter
Speech Type: Noun
Etymology:
late 16th century: via Latin from Greek sphinktēr, from sphingein ‘bind tight’
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
ˈsfɪŋ(k)tə
Dialects: British English
Definition:
a ring of muscle surrounding and serving to guard or close an opening or tube, such as the anus or the openings of the stomach
Short Definition:ring of muscle surrounding and serving to guard or close opening or tube
Examples:- the anal sphincter
